Is it possible to take the PDF files off the CDs and use them from
your hard drive?
Yes, you can copy the SCWC catalog from the disk onto your computer's
hard drive. There is no "protection" which prevents this.
It's not a bad feature, although taking a PC around a bourse is
probably even more pretentious than lugging the catalogs and checking
every damn coin against its pricing. However, if one takes their PC
to a long-distance coin show (especially one where you must fly-in),
it would save taking the catalogs.
The disk is a nice addition, but I will probably always want the
printed book too.
